    FINAL SCORE

    Gold Coast Titans 38


    Tries: Laffranchi x2, Rogers x2, Graham, Petersen, Webster
    Goals: Campbell 3/4, Delaney 2/3


    Parramatta Eels 12


    Tries: Marsh, Hindmarsh
    Goals: Burt 2/2


    Today we found out what happens when a team comes out with enthusiasm and commitment to a cause, and that is that they can do extraordinary things.

    The boys from the Titans were sensational today, but it all came down to the fact they all came out as 17 men who wanted to do their team proud and who were all really excited to be there and to play.

    The difference between the GC and Parra today was that the GC boys ran up in tackles in defense, were running at everything in attack and there was just really good communication, with the absolute opposite in the Eels... they tried hard, but couldn't pull it off, they were just not cohesive enough against a slick Titans outfit.

    I reckon the team can make the top 8 if it can keep this up and stay away from injuries, because everyone is playing at 110% and therefore are coming up with some stunning plays on the back of Magicians Prince and Campbell... the support is amazing and the play is terrific.
